Hawthorne’s location matters for your garage door. The marine layer rolls in from the Pacific just a few miles west, carrying salt-laden moisture that corrodes torsion springs, cables, and bottom brackets years ahead of inland schedules. Add the low-altitude aircraft traffic from LAX directly overhead, and you’ve got vibration loosening hardware that inland cities simply don’t experience. We don’t guess at these patterns. We’ve documented them across hundreds of Hawthorne service calls.

Spring Repair in Hawthorne
Torsion springs in Hawthorne corrode and snap prematurely. The salt-laden marine layer deposits chlorides on exposed metal, eating through standard oil-tempered springs in 4–6 years instead of the 8–12 you’d expect inland. We recently serviced a 1950s tract home on 135th Street in the 90250 zip code where the torsion springs were so corroded from salt air that one snapped mid-cycle, and the trolley carriage bolts had vibrated loose from weeks of aircraft flyovers. We replaced both springs with heavy-duty galvanized units, swapped the carriage bolts for thread-locked stainless fasteners, and installed nylon rollers to reduce future noise and wear. A typical spring repair in Hawthorne runs $180–$340.

Cable Repair in Hawthorne
Bottom brackets and lift cables corrode faster here than in drier cities. The persistent coastal humidity wicks into cable windings, causing internal rust that frays cables from the inside out. We inspect for this hidden damage rather than just replacing the visible break. Galvanized or stainless cables are worth the upgrade in Hawthorne’s environment. Cable repair in Hawthorne typically costs $130–$250.

Track Realignment in Hawthorne
Vibration from LAX flight paths loosens track mounting hardware, causing vertical tracks to shift and bind the door. We see this pattern concentrated in the flight corridors over 90250 neighborhoods near Prairie Avenue and Crenshaw. Our track realignment includes checking every jamb bracket bolt, not just the obvious bend. Track realignment in Hawthorne generally runs $120–$240.

Common Garage Door Repair Problems We See in Hawthorne Homes
- Corroded torsion springs snapping early. Salt-air corrosion from the marine layer penetrates spring coatings and causes premature fatigue fractures, often at 4–6 years instead of the normal 8–12.
- Trolley carriage bolts vibrating loose. Low-frequency aircraft vibration from LAX flyovers works fasteners loose on opener rail systems, especially in homes under the approach corridors near 135th Street and El Segundo Boulevard.
- Bottom bracket and cable corrosion. The same salt-laden moisture that attacks springs corrodes lift cables and bottom brackets, causing door imbalance and sudden cable failure.
- Track misalignment from shifted mounting. Vibration plus thermal cycling of Hawthorne’s older wood frame garages loosens track jamb brackets, creating binding and roller pop-out.

Galvanized or powder-coated torsion springs, stainless steel cables and bottom brackets, and nylon rollers outperform standard hardware in Hawthorne’s salt-air environment. We recommend these as standard upgrades, not premium upsells, because they cost less over a 10-year ownership period than repeated replacement of corroded standard components.
